Olive Branch (Miss.) took the final lead of the game on Saturday as
Samuel Craft thew a touchdown to
Malik Mayweather with under a minute left, bringing the team to victory over
DeSoto Central (Southaven, Miss.) 31-28.
The Conquistadors saw their 9-point halftime lead fall to five entering the fourth.
Olive Branch's most effective player was Craft. The senior quarterback threw one touchdown and ran for one touchdown. He has now scored 12 touchdowns on the season.
The Jaguars'
Kendal Bunch played well. He ran for two touchdowns. His performance brought his touchdown total to three on the year.
DeSoto Central came in surrendering 14.3 points per game this season. DC struggled against OB's offense, which entered the game scoring 30.8 points per game.
The Conquistadors also won the meeting between the two teams last season, 62-21.
The loss comes after DeSoto Central defeated Horn Lake 39-14 last week. The win was a nice bounce back for Olive Branch, which lost to South Panola last week, 28-14.
DeSoto Central (5-2) will play a 6A Region 1 game against Columbus next week, while Olive Branch (6-1) will take on Horn Lake also in a 6A Region 1 game.
